V.W.H. TEAM EVENT SUNDAY 20th FEBRUARY 2005

Please read these rules, they are for all participants.

  1. Class 1 & 2. Teams to consist of 3 or 4 horses, the fastest 3 to count.
  2. Class 3 . Teams to consist of 3 or 4 horses. Judged [on a bogey time] on the 3rd horse to finish.
  3. Teams must jump all the fences in numerical order between the marker flags. Any horse taking the wrong course will be eliminated.
  4. If there is a pen on the course, 12 horse feet must be in the pen at once. If not a 20 second penalty will be added to the finishing time.
  5. Any team not completing the course within 10 minutes will be eliminated.
  6. Three refusals at any one fence or five in total will eliminate the horse and rider. Failure to stop and the whole team will be eliminated.
  7. The Chief Mounted Steward will be riding round the course. He/she has the authority to stop any horse that is tired, lame or being treated in an unsuitable manner. He/she must be obeyed, if not the whole team will be eliminated.
  8. Team members numbers will be issued at the Secretary’s lorry for a deposit of £10.00.
  9. Each team will be given a starting time. Please be in the collecting ring at least 15 minutes before your starting time.
  10. No horse or pony may compete more than once.
  11. Riders are requested to wear hats that comply to the current safety standards. Back protectors must be worn.
  12. It is a requirement that all participants must have third party insurance for not less than £5M. It is also recommended that all participants hold personal accident insurance.
  13. The Judges decision will be final at all times. Objections must be lodged with the secretary within 10 minutes of the end of the class and will cost £20.00.
  14. Competitors may exercise their horses in the area provided.
  15. The organisers do not accept liability for any accident, injury or illness to horses, owners, riders, grooms, spectators or any other persons or property on the ground.
  16. All cars, lorries and horseboxes are parked at owners risk. No responsibility is accepted for damage to or loss from the above parked on the ground.
  17. The organisers reserve the right to:- alter the advertised times, refuse any entry without reason, alter the course or leave out any fence before or during the competition or eliminate any competitor not adhering to the rules.
  18. In the event of postponement due to weather etc. no refund will be made. If cancelled 75% of entry fees will be refunded.
  19. After the drop of the starter flag exchanging horses is not allowed.
  20. Dogs must be kept on leads at all times.
  21. Small children must be supervised at all times.
